Warning Signs You Need Groundwater Seepage Removal

Catching groundwater seepage issues early on can save you thousands of dollars in repairs. Keep an eye out for these warning signs and take prompt action to prevent further damage: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ent odors can show moisture buildup and seepage. If you notice a musty smell in your home, it’s essential to investigate further and address the issue quickly.

Water Stains on Ceilings and Walls

Water stains can be a sign of seepage or leaks. If you notice water stains on your ceilings or walls, it’s crucial to investigate the source of the issue and take corrective action.

Warped or Buckled Floors

Warped or buckled floors can show moisture damage and seepage. If you notice any changes in your flooring,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.

Visible Water Damage or Leaks

Visible water damage or leaks can be a clear indication of seepage. If you notice any signs of water damage or leaks, it’s crucial to take prompt action to prevent further damage.

High Humidity Levels

High humidity levels can contribute to moisture buildup and seepage. If you notice high humidity levels in your home, it’s essential to take corrective action to reduce moisture levels and prevent further damage.

Mold or Mildew Growth

Mold or mildew growth can be a sign of moisture buildup and seepage. If you notice any signs of mold or mildew growth, it’s crucial to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.

Common Questions About Groundwater Seepage Removal

Q: What causes groundwater seepage?

A: Groundwater seepage is typically caused by excess moisture in the soil, which can come from various sources, including heavy rainfall, poor drainage, or cracks in the foundation. Q: Can I prevent groundwater seepage damage?

A: Yes, there are several steps you can take to prevent groundwater seepage damage, including installing a French drain, improving drainage around your property, and sealing any cracks in the foundation.
